How AC repair costs are built in the Fox River Valley
When you call for cooling help in Aurora, Joliet, Naperville, Bolingbrook, or Yorkville, your final invoice usually includes four pieces:
- Diagnostic fee
- A flat rate to inspect, test, and identify the fault.
- Labor
- The time a licensed technician spends repairing your system.
- Parts and materials
- Components like capacitors, motors, contactors, coils, or refrigerant.
- After-hours premium if applicable
- For late night, weekend, or holiday responses.

Two quick facts that shape pricing across the industry:
- The U.S. Department of Energy reports that air conditioners use about 6 percent of all electricity in the United States, costing homeowners billions each year. Efficient, correct repairs protect comfort and energy spend.
- Under the federal AIM Act, high global-warming potential HFC refrigerants are being phased down by 85 percent by 2036. This policy pressure has already influenced the market price of legacy refrigerants.
Local insight: Cottonwood fluff along the Fox River can clog outdoor coils in late spring. Dirty coils force longer run times, which can trip capacitors or overheat fan motors. A simple clean can prevent a bigger bill.
Common AC repairs and typical price ranges
Every brand and install is different, but these ballpark ranges help you budget:
- Capacitor replacement: 150 to 400 dollars
- Contactor or relay: 150 to 350 dollars
- Condensate drain unclog/clean: 150 to 350 dollars
- Thermostat replacement and setup: 200 to 500 dollars
- Refrigerant leak search and minor repair: 350 to 1,500 dollars, plus refrigerant as needed
- Refrigerant recharge after verified repair: 200 to 600 dollars depending on type and amount
- Condenser fan motor: 300 to 700 dollars
- Blower motor replacement: 450 to 900 dollars
- Evaporator coil replacement: 1,200 to 2,500 dollars
- Compressor replacement: 1,800 to 3,500 dollars
Why ranges vary:
- Tonnage and model complexity
- Part brand and warranty status
- Accessibility in attics, crawl spaces, or tight pads
- Local permitting requirements for major component swaps

What drives AC repair cost up or down
- System age and condition
- Older units may have multiple marginal parts. Fixing one failure can reveal others.
- Refrigerant type
- Legacy HFCs affected by the federal phasedown can cost more per pound.
- Installation quality
- Poor airflow or non-level pads strain components, causing repeat failures.
- Electrical and airflow issues
- Voltage drops, dirty filters, and clogged coils mimic expensive failures.
- Access and code compliance
- Roof units or tight closets take longer. Some cities require permits and final inspections for coil or condenser replacements.
Smart homeowner moves that lower your bill:
- Replace filters on schedule, especially during cottonwood season.
- Clear 2 feet of space around outdoor units.
- Call early when you hear grinding or see icing. Small problems grow.

Repair or replace: make the math work
Use the 5,000 rule as a simple screen: multiply the system age by the quoted repair cost. If the number is over 5,000, replacement often makes more sense. Example: a 12-year-old unit with a 600 dollar repair equals 7,200, which suggests pricing a replacement.
Consider replacement if:
- The compressor or coil needs replacement outside warranty.
- You face repeat refrigerant leaks or rising refrigerant costs.
- Energy bills have climbed and comfort is uneven.
Consider repair if:
- The unit is under 10 years old and parts are in warranty.
- The fault is simple, like a capacitor, contactor, or drain.
- Airflow and thermostat issues can be corrected affordably.

How to compare quotes apples to apples
- Ask for a written diagnostic summary and part numbers.
- Confirm warranty on parts and labor in writing.
- Verify that the quote includes refrigerant, electrical corrections, and cleanup.
- Check the company’s license status and background checks for techs.
- Weigh response time. A stocked truck that arrives today can save a second trip fee.

Frequently Asked Questions
How long does an AC repair usually take?
Most AC repairs can be completed within a few hours, especially when the technician arrives with a fully stocked truck.
Why did my quote include refrigerant if the leak was small?
Refrigerant must be restored to the correct level after a verified repair. Federal HFC phasedown pressures can influence the per-pound price.
Do I need a permit for AC repairs?
Minor repairs rarely need permits. Major component replacements or full system swaps may require a local permit and inspection.
